Введение: Файл functions.php является одним из ключевых файлов в WordPress, который позволяет вам настраивать и расширять функциональность вашего сайта. В этой статье мы рассмотрим возможности настройки WordPress через файл functions.php, включая создание пользовательских функций и хуков.
- Что такое файл functions.php: Файл functions.php является частью темы WordPress и содержит код, который выполняется перед загрузкой вашего сайта. Он позволяет вам добавлять свои собственные функции, изменять поведение WordPress и расширять функциональность с помощью хуков.
- Создание пользовательских функций: Вы можете использовать файл functions.php для создания собственных пользовательских функций. Это может быть полезно, когда вам нужно добавить дополнительную функциональность или изменить существующую. Например, вы можете создать функцию для изменения логики работы сайдбаров или добавить новые возможности для работы с контентом.
- Использование хуков: Хуки в WordPress позволяют вам встраиваться в различные этапы обработки запроса и встраивать свой код. Вы можете использовать хуки для добавления своих действий или фильтров на определенные события. Например, вы можете использовать хук «init» для регистрации новых типов записей или хук «wp_enqueue_scripts» для добавления стилей и скриптов на страницу.
- Оптимизация и настройка: Файл functions.php также позволяет вам проводить оптимизацию вашего сайта и настраивать различные аспекты работы WordPress. Вы можете использовать его для отключения ненужных функций, добавления настроек темы или изменения настроек безопасности.
- Безопасность и проверка ошибок: При написании кода в файле functions.php важно обеспечить безопасность и проверку ошибок. Используйте санитайзеры для фильтрации вводимых данных и проверяйте наличие ошибок при разработке. Это поможет избежать уязвимостей и повысит стабильность вашего сайта.
Заключение: Файл functions.php является мощным инструментом для настройки и расширения функциональности вашего сайта на WordPress. Создание пользовательских функций и использование хуков позволяет вам влиять на работу сайта и внешний вид. Помните о безопасности и проверке ошибок при разработке кода. Используйте файл functions.php для оптимизации и настройки вашего сайта на WordPress.